Building Apps with React Native and Its Benefits

What’s the popularity of a smartphone without its apps? They are essential today and inevitable for even the simplest of tasks. From communication and social media to ordering food and listening to music, they’ve taken over the digital world with ease. Such a vital part of our daily lives can’t be coded just for namesake. Mobile apps need to be functional, practical, attractive, and user-friendly. 

Any successful mobile app should be:

  • Compatible: The app needs to function effectively for the device and its operating system.
  • User friendly and appealing: The app can’t have over the top, interfering graphics. It needs to look good and also function well without disturbing the normal usage.
  • Unique and branded: There’s no point assimilating into the plethora of apps available. Your app needs to stand out and create an impression on its users.
  • Suitable for its purpose: Apps must fit the target demographic and the audience your app will be helpful for. Its design needs to find all the boxes suitable.

Many app frameworks, such as React Native, make their app efficient and foolproof in less time. The JavaScript-based framework helps you create the best apps from scratch or existing apps for the best User Interface and User Experience.

How Does React Native Help?

An app framework is a blessing for developers that are just starting. The qualities of React Native development are:

  • Great Coding: React Native comprises JavaScript and is rendered with their native code. They’re compatible with many platforms and help create platform-specific technology with ease.
  • Native user experience: You don’t have to compromise on your unique ideas as the platform’s agnostic components help you access the UI building blocks without any complications.
  • Versatile: The framework is used to wrap already existing code for usage across different platforms. It makes the work for new developers and existing ones much faster.
  • Speed: React Native helps developers work at lighting speech with instant saving. As and when it gets completed, the work can be saved, iterated, and edited in no time.

Advantages of Building Apps with React Native

The development toolkit created by Facebook helps beginners stride across the most appealing apps with an extensive choice of the best elements in the market. The technology comes with benefits such as:

  1. Less Development Time: Most parts of the reusable code offered can be used across many platforms, making it easy to edit the existing work simply. From amateurs to professionals, a prebuilt framework can surely enhance their speed.
  2. Affordable: It is much cheaper to apply React Native than develop native codes for different operating systems. The reusable framework makes it simpler for integration and creation.
  3. Engaging UI/UX Interface: Nobody wants to use an app like a storybook. Any successful app needs to be interactive and requires responses from its users. The job is made that much easier with components like Picker, Button, Slider, and etc.
  4. Credibility: React Native developers guaranteed success as apps like Facebook, Skype, F8, Instagram, and Bloomberg were all built on the platform. The framework ensures foolproof app development with cross-platform compatibility.
  5. Transfer and testing: Native App developers assure the app’s quality through a range of test runs before app release. The native code you already use for apps can also be migrated and edited by the developers hassle-free.

Conclusion

React Native development has been proven to be cost-effective and have the best quality. Companies like Fireart help scale your app as your users increase and make sure that the performance and animation are on point. With crowd-pleasing reviews and chart-topping applications, they might be your answer for your app to be its best!